Abstract

Described herein are systems and methods for providing machine-learning system functionalities. A system can maintain a plurality of data structures corresponding to a plurality of events, each associated with a data structure type. The system can establish a communication session with a client device and receive a prompt comprising a request. The system can classify the request, generate an input context using the prompt and classification, and generate, via the language model, output comprising a data structure defining formatting of a graphical element for at least one selected data structure. The output can be provided to the client device, causing the device to parse the data structure and render the graphical element in a graphical user interface.

Claims (63)

1 . A system, comprising:

one or more processors coupled to non-transitory memory, the one or more processors configured to:

maintain a plurality of wager opportunities corresponding to a plurality of live events, each of the plurality of wager opportunities corresponding to a wager type;

establish a communication session with a client device;

receive, from the client device during the communication session, a prompt for a language model comprising a request;

determine a classification of the request included in the prompt;

generate an input context for the language model using the prompt and the classification;

generate, using the language model and the input context, output comprising a data structure corresponding to formatting of a graphical element for at least one wager recommendation selected based on the prompt; and

provide the output to the client device in response to the request, the output causing the client device to parse the data structure and generate the graphical element for display in a graphical user interface.
